First-time feature filmmaker Tony Stone follows the treacherous journey of two Vikings who must fend for themselves in the New World after their party is attacked and they are forced to flee into unfamiliar territory. The year is 1007 A.D., and an expedition of Vikings has arrived on the shores of North America in search of a fabled Vinland. Shortly after two scouts set foot on land to explore the uncharted interior, the ships are attacked by "Skralings" and forced to retreat to safety. Left for dead by their frightened fellow countrymen, the two scouts make their way north in hopes of reuniting with their party. But life in the New World isn't like life back in the Old World, and as the two wandering Norsemen are plagued by memories of a distant past one sets out on a spiritual quest as the other embraces his primal instincts. While at first it appears as if the adventurers are alone in the New World, the discovery of Native Americans and Irish Monks finds what was initially a modest expedition of necessity gradually taking on epic undertones.
